Output 8e685fc2d06b23187d8ae0357bfe1131e58410357a62a81911de80c22da68361:0

value
3020338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522698bfb2ed9d7b65e9c0260726b35ed26d2c47 OP_EQUAL
address
39BPa1zHzJWf1aCdtgviafyrTcDbbzWuEc
transaction
8e685fc2d06b23187d8ae0357bfe1131e58410357a62a81911de80c22da68361
spent
true